Eating your own dogfood
UnderpaidLoveMonki @ 10:36 am March 3rd, 2007This article hits the nail on the head - a very good read.
Dogfooding is…
To say that a company “eats its own dog food” means that it uses the products that it makes … The metaphor of a company “eating its own dog food” takes this idea one step further to say that the company has not merely considered the value of the product for consumers (that is, whether the dog will eat the dog food), but actually is a consumer of the product. - Wikipedia
It boils down to,
When poorly executed the practice of dog-food can have a very large negative impact on an organization. The practice of dog-fooding needs to be predicated by high quality software to be effective.
On another note relating to quality, I found this quote from Agile Advice:
The bitterness of poor quality lasts longer than the sweet taste of meeting a deadline.
All of this can be compiled into one of agile software development practices - “Quality is not negotiable.”





